Just over a week left to submit your work to the @ACMMobiSys 2022 Workshop on Emerging Devices for Digital Biomarkers! Check out our website for the Call for Papers and more details: https://t.co/vBJxxzbfcw
Topics of interest include novel #hardware, signal processing, or #ml for #digitalhealth, unique #biomarkers from emerging devices, #privacy and #security recommendations, #dataviz for emerging devices, and more.

The workshop will foster discussion on novel sensing opportunities and challenges of using devices like headsets, on-body and in-home sensors, and brain-computer interfaces for the collection of digital biomarkers. See https://t.co/vBJxxyTDNW for more details.
